What to know when moving to Miami, FL
Welcome to Miami, a city that boasts year-round sunshine and a vibrant mix of cultures. When considering a move within, or to this bustling metropolis, you're looking at warm winters and hot summers, meaning beach days are never far off. Miami's proximity to other major cities like Fort Lauderdale and the international allure of South Beach ensures there's always something to explore.
Don't forget the iconic Freedom Tower, which stands as a testament to the city's rich history and cultural diversity. For up-to-date information, check out Miami and Beaches.
Where do people move from Miami?
People move long distance from Miami to popular cities like Austin TX, New York NY and Washington DC.
Popular destinations within Florida include Fort Lauderdale, Orlando and Tampa.
